Product Details

Our luxuriously soft beach towels are made from brushed microfiber with a 100% cotton back for extra absorption.   The top of the towel has the image printed on it, and the back is white cotton.   Our beach towels are available in two different sizes: beach towel (32" x 64") and beach sheet (37" x 74").

Don't let the fancy name confuse you... a beach sheet is just a large beach towel.

Artist's Description

The Flume Gorge Covered Bridge Crosses The Pemigewasset River And Spans Just Over 40 Feet With A Total Length Of 50 Feet In The Town Of Lincoln, New Hampshire At Franconia Notch State Park In New England.
